TVOM: "Since debuting on Broadway in 1965 as Neil Simon’s The Odd Couple, the ageless story of Felix Unger and Oscar Madison has been adapted five times on film, the latest being CBS’s first new comedy of 2015. Starring Matthew Perry as Oscar and Thomas Lennon as Felix, this particular iteration of The Odd Couple turns the timeless dissonance of Felix and Oscar’s friendship into a toothless “buddy” comedy whose strongest feature – at least in the pilot – is some barely-disguised gay panic. Developed by Perry and Mad About You/Two Guys and a Girl EP Danny Jacobson, The Odd Couple is the latest failed attempt to bring Matthew Perry back to TV, and the worst of the bunch yet."
